Current Features of the Lifx Z Series
As of 2024, the Lifx Z features a wide color spectrum, allowing users to choose from over 16 million colors. Its brightness reaches up to 950 lumens per strip, making it suitable for various lighting needs. The system supports multiple zones, enabling dynamic lighting effects across different sections of a room.
